We stayed at the Albergo Italia on a Friday and Saturday night in mid-May. The hotel is very easily accessed from the parking garage under the city. The location is convenient and an easy walk to restaurants and attractions. It is close to the piazza but QUIET. The desk staff are pleasant and very helpful. The room, 310, was spacious... More

Clean, comfortable, excellent location, friendly helpful staff and an excellent breakfast. Oh, and free wifi. Hotel is centrally located so is close to everything the village has to offer, including bars, restaurants, history and of course the Piero della Francesca paintings in the Ducal Palace. Parking in medieval Italian hill towns is a problem, but the hotel is close to... More
